If true, this will suck once I hit inferno
Because what I do now is run up to the champ/rare mobs and do the following...
1. Vortex them in using Ground Stomp (Wrenching Smash)
2. Hit Wrath of the Berserker (Insanity) - 15 sec duration
3. Drop Earthquake (Path of Fire) - 8 sec duration
4. Hit Ignore Pain (Ignorance is Bliss) - 5 sec duration
By using a good 2-hander and the above in the order specified (due to skill duration) I kill most, if not all of the champs/rare and any other mobs around and I'm kept full life the entire time.
The only thing that sucks about the above method is when I get champ/rare mobs that run away from me and I can't vortex all of them in at once. :/
